Capability

Web Scraping API

Scrape any site. No browser to manage. Extract structured data from any website. Full JavaScript rendering, dynamic content support, and automatic pagination, all from a single API endpoint.. BrowserSolver handles the infrastructure so your team can focus on what matters.

Quick Start

A single HTTP request is all you need. No SDK, no dependencies.

Loading...

How It Works

1

Send a Request

POST a JSON body or use GET with query parameters. No SDK or library needed.

2

Get Your Image

BrowserSolver executes your browser session, automation flow, barcode, QR code, or label request and returns it as PNG or SVG.

3

Use It Anywhere

Embed in emails, PDFs, dashboards, documents, or print directly. Works everywhere images work.

Features

Full JS Rendering

Execute JavaScript, wait for dynamic content, handle SPAs and lazy-loaded data before extraction.

Stealth Mode

Fingerprint randomization and residential proxies bypass anti-bot systems on the most protected sites.

Structured Output

Get data as JSON, Markdown, or plain text. Define CSS selectors or let the AI extract what you need.

CAPTCHA Solving

Automatic CAPTCHA solving for hCaptcha, reCAPTCHA v2/v3, and Cloudflare Turnstile.

Use Cases

  • Price monitoring across e-commerce sites
  • Lead generation from business directories
  • Real estate listing aggregation
  • News and content aggregation pipelines
  • Competitor product and pricing intelligence
  • Financial data extraction from public sources

Frequently Asked Questions

How does the Web Scraping API work?

Send a request to the BrowserSolver API with your target URL and parameters. BrowserSolver launches a cloud browser, renders the page fully, and returns the result in your chosen format. No local browser or infrastructure needed.

Does it work with JavaScript-heavy sites?

Yes. BrowserSolver uses a real Chromium browser, so all JavaScript executes normally. Configure wait conditions to ensure dynamic content loads fully before extraction.

How does stealth mode help with bot detection?

Each session gets a unique browser fingerprint and is routed through a residential proxy. Combined, this makes the browser indistinguishable from a real user, bypassing Cloudflare, Akamai, and PerimeterX protections.

What output formats are available?

Depending on the endpoint: JSON for structured data extraction, Markdown for content, HTML for raw page source, PNG/JPEG for screenshots, and PDF for full-page renders.

Can I process multiple URLs in parallel?

Yes. Send batch requests with multiple URLs and BrowserSolver processes them concurrently. Scale to hundreds of simultaneous sessions without managing any infrastructure.

Is there a free tier to get started?

Yes. Sign up for a free API key and start with the included free credits. No credit card required to get started. Anonymous access is available for basic testing.

Ready to build without browser headaches?

Join engineering teams shipping AI agents and automation at scale. No browser fleet to manage, no infra to maintain, just call the API and go.